Photography What Type of Photography is Best for Beginners? John, September 15, 2023September 15, 2023 Have you recently purchased a camera and are eager to start taking pictures? As a beginner, it can be overwhelming to choose which type of photography to focus on. With so many options available, it’s important to find the one that best fits your interests and skill level. Landscape photography involves capturing the beauty of nature and the outdoors. It can include mountains, beaches, forests, grass, and more. To get started, find a scenic location and experiment with different angles and compositions. Consider using a tripod to keep your camera steady and a polarizing filter to enhance colors. Wedding photography involves capturing the special moments of a wedding ceremony and reception. It can include posed or candid shots, and can be done indoors or outdoors. To get started, find a couple who is willing to let you practice and experiment with different poses and lighting. Consider using a telephoto lens to capture candid moments from a distance. Photography What Makes a Good Wedding Photo? John, August 19, 2023September 15, 2023 When it comes to your wedding day, you want everything to be perfect, and that includes your wedding photos. After all, these pictures will be cherished memories for years to come. But what makes a good wedding photo? Is it the lighting, the composition, or the emotions captured? In this article, we’ll explore the key elements that make a wedding photo great. The best wedding photos are those that capture genuine emotions. Whether it’s a tearful moment between the bride and her father or a joyful laugh shared between the newlyweds, emotion is what makes a photo truly special. As a photographer, your job is to be ready to capture those fleeting moments of emotion as they happen. Composition is another important factor to consider when taking wedding photos. A well-composed photo can make all the difference in creating a visually stunning image. Consider the rule of thirds, leading lines, and symmetry when composing your shots. Continue Reading
